Within this position, the Planner will conduct community consultations, recommend policy and guidelines on land use, environmental issues, transportation, and housing, prepare reports on demographic, economic, cultural, and social issues, and prepare plans for developing private land or public spaces.
The ideal candidate will have experience serving as a Municipal / City / Urban Planner and have a thorough understanding of community development. Those with the New Jersey Professional Planner (PP) license and AICP Certification are encouraged to apply, along within those who have the ability and desire to become licensed within the next few years!
- Assist with all aspects of assigned projects, including, but not limited to :
- Review of land use applications for consistency with municipal ordinances
- Development of new and reexamination of existing municipal Master Plans and associated elements
- Application of statutory / regulatory criteria for Redevelopment Area / Rehabilitation Area designations
- Preparation of Redevelopment Plans, analyses for conformance with various governmental programs or designations
- Represent the firm during the public hearing process
- Prepares applications to local land use boards, including planning reports with Variance justifications, for development applications on behalf of private clients
- Serves as Project Manager for assigned projects executing all aspects of project management including communicating with the client, maintaining schedules and meeting deadlines, delivering quality service and products, and meeting budgets
- Coordinate with survey, planning and engineering staff as a part of the application and review process
- Plans, schedules, and coordinates the preparation of reports, maps, activities, or other deliverables for assigned projects
- Employs best practices and standard operational procedures to ensure compliance with applicable laws, rules and policies
- Works collaboratively with and supports organizational efforts to develop new markets, secure work and enhance client relationships
